news 2026/6/12 0:57:36

5个常见问题解析:为什么容器音乐服务找不到你的本地歌曲

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
5个常见问题解析:为什么容器音乐服务找不到你的本地歌曲

5个常见问题解析:为什么容器音乐服务找不到你的本地歌曲

【免费下载链接】xiaomusic使用小爱同学播放音乐,音乐使用 yt-dlp 下载。项目地址: https://gitcode.com/GitHub_Trending/xia/xiaomusic

还在为容器部署的音乐服务无法显示本地歌曲而烦恼吗?🤔 很多用户在Docker环境中部署xiaomusic时都会遇到这个典型问题:明明设备识别正常,音乐文件就在那里,但播放列表却空空如也。别担心,今天我们就来彻底解决这个"看得见摸不着"的尴尬局面!

🎯 问题根源快速定位

当容器音乐服务无法加载本地音乐时,通常有三大"拦路虎"在作祟:

路径映射错位:就像给朋友指路,你说的是"我家小区",而他理解的是"整个城市"——容器内外路径不一致导致音乐文件"失联"。

权限屏障阻挡:想象一下你拿着正确的钥匙,但门锁却换了——文件权限设置不当让容器无法读取音乐文件。

配置细节疏忽:一个小小的斜杠或者空格,都可能让整个系统"迷路"。

🔍 实战排查四步走

第一步:检查目录挂载的"双向通道"

容器部署就像在两个房间之间建立通道,必须确保路径完全匹配:

# 正确示例:内外路径严格对应 docker run -v /host/music:/container/music xiaomusic # 常见错误:路径不一致或多余字符 docker run -v /music:/container/music/ # 尾部斜杠问题

实用小贴士:在web管理界面配置音乐目录时,务必使用容器内部路径,就像告诉朋友"请到我家的书房"而不是"请到我家小区"。

第二步:打通文件权限的"任督二脉"

权限问题是最容易被忽视的细节。记住这个黄金法则:

  • 宿主机目录权限:至少755(drwxr-xr-x)
  • 音乐文件权限:建议644(-rw-r--r--)
  • 快速检测命令:ls -la /your/music/path

第三步:验证配置的"精准导航"

配置界面中的路径设置需要特别注意:

  • 保持与挂载路径完全一致
  • 避免路径末尾的"/"字符
  • 配置保存后重启服务生效

第四步:深度诊断的"专家视角"

如果以上步骤都正常,问题可能藏在更深层:

容器日志分析:通过docker logs xiaomusic-container查看详细错误信息

文件系统检查:确认音乐文件格式兼容性(MP3、FLAC等常见格式)

网络隔离影响:某些Docker网络模式可能影响文件访问

💡 成功案例分享

最近帮助一位用户解决了类似问题,他的情况很有代表性:

初始状态

  • Docker命令:-v /mnt/music:/music
  • 界面配置:/mnt/music

问题分析:用户混淆了宿主机路径和容器内路径

解决方案

  1. 保持Docker挂载配置不变
  2. 将web界面中的音乐目录改为容器内路径/music
  3. 重启服务后立即生效 ✅

🛠️ 预防性部署建议

为了避免重复踩坑,建议采用以下最佳实践:

标准化目录结构

mkdir -p /data/xiaomusic/music chmod -R 755 /data/xiaomusic

部署前检查清单

  • 宿主机目录存在且不为空
  • 文件权限设置正确
  • 挂载路径内外一致
  • 配置界面使用容器内路径

快速测试方法: 进入容器内部手动验证:

docker exec -it xiaomusic-container bash ls -la /music # 应该能看到音乐文件

🎉 总结与展望

通过系统化的排查方法,容器音乐服务的目录挂载问题完全可以轻松解决。记住核心要点:路径一致、权限足够、配置准确。只要按照这个思路逐步检查,你的本地音乐很快就能在容器环境中畅快播放!

还在等什么?赶紧检查你的部署配置,让音乐重新响起来吧!🎵

【免费下载链接】xiaomusic使用小爱同学播放音乐,音乐使用 yt-dlp 下载。项目地址: https://gitcode.com/GitHub_Trending/xia/xiaomusic

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/6/12 7:53:46

如何轻松获取Sketchfab海量3D模型:免费获取终极指南

还在为Sketchfab平台上精美的3D模型无法获取而烦恼吗?这款专为Firefox浏览器设计的用户脚本工具将彻底改变你的3D资源获取方式。无论你是设计师、开发者还是数字艺术爱好者,只需简单配置,就能轻松获取完整的模型文件。 【免费下载链接】sketc…

作者头像 李华
网站建设 2026/6/11 9:12:04

轻松解锁Beyond Compare 5:本地授权密钥生成全攻略

轻松解锁Beyond Compare 5:本地授权密钥生成全攻略 【免费下载链接】BCompare_Keygen Keygen for BCompare 5 项目地址: https://gitcode.com/gh_mirrors/bc/BCompare_Keygen 还在为Beyond Compare 5的评估期限制而烦恼吗?想要免费享受专业版的所…

作者头像 李华
网站建设 2026/6/11 17:07:00

unrpyc终极指南:5分钟学会Ren‘Py反编译的完整教程

unrpyc终极指南:5分钟学会RenPy反编译的完整教程 【免费下载链接】unrpyc A renpy script decompiler 项目地址: https://gitcode.com/gh_mirrors/un/unrpyc unrpyc是一款专业的RenPy脚本反编译工具,能够将编译后的.rpyc文件还原为可读的.rpy源代…

作者头像 李华
网站建设 2026/6/11 18:38:11

BetterNCM安装器使用全攻略:解锁网易云音乐隐藏功能

BetterNCM安装器使用全攻略:解锁网易云音乐隐藏功能 【免费下载链接】BetterNCM-Installer 一键安装 Better 系软件 项目地址: https://gitcode.com/gh_mirrors/be/BetterNCM-Installer 还在为网易云音乐功能单一而烦恼吗?想要打造专属的音乐播放…

作者头像 李华
网站建设 2026/6/12 4:44:32

鸿蒙阅读神器:从零打造你的私人数字图书馆 [特殊字符]

还在为广告满天飞的阅读应用烦恼吗?开源阅读鸿蒙版为你带来纯净无干扰的沉浸式阅读体验!这款免费开源的阅读器不仅支持自定义书源抓取全网内容,还能完美管理本地文件,让你随心所欲打造专属的数字书房。 【免费下载链接】legado-Ha…

作者头像 李华
网站建设 2026/6/9 11:59:08

3分钟解锁小爱音箱音乐超能力:XiaoMusic深度配置实战指南

3分钟解锁小爱音箱音乐超能力:XiaoMusic深度配置实战指南 【免费下载链接】xiaomusic 使用小爱同学播放音乐,音乐使用 yt-dlp 下载。 项目地址: https://gitcode.com/GitHub_Trending/xia/xiaomusic 还在为小爱音箱无法播放心仪歌曲而烦恼&#x…

作者头像 李华